文件权限在操作系统中扮演着至关重要的角色,它直接影响到数据的安全性和系统的稳定性。正确管理文件的读写访问不仅可以保护敏感信息,还能够提高系统性能。近年来,随着云计算、物联网等新兴技术的发展,文件权限管理的复杂性和重要性愈发显著。了解操作系统中的文件权限及其管理策略显得尤为重要。

文件权限主要包括读、写和执行三种基本操作。对于每一个文件或目录,操作系统都为不同的用户或用户组分配相应的访问权限。以Linux系统为例,权限由三个部分组成:用户(owner)、用户组(group)和其他(others),每个部分都可以单独设置权限。这种灵活的权限管理机制可以让系统管理员根据需要调整文件的可访问性,从而有效控制数据的流动。
近年来,市场上出现了多种增强文件权限管理的工具和软件,例如ACL(访问控制列表)和SELinux(安全增强Linux)。ACL允许在单个文件上设定多种权限,大大提高了权限管理的精细度。而SELinux则提供了更为强大的安全性,通过强制访问控制(MAC)机制,确保系统的安全不受漏洞影响。这些新技术为操作系统的文件权限管理带来了新的机遇,也增添了系统管理员的工作复杂性。
对于DIY组装的技术爱好者和开发人员,学习并理解操作系统文件权限的管理技巧是至关重要的。一个常见的组装技巧就是在设置操作系统时,根据使用场景分配合理的权限。例如,如果系统将用于开发,可以将源代码文件夹设置为可写权限,而不必要的系统文件则应尽量限制访问。通过这种针对性的管理,可以有效减少潜在的安全隐患。
性能优化同样是管理文件权限的重要方面。合理的文件权限可以避免不必要的资源消耗和潜在的安全威胁。例如,确保仅有了权限的用户可以对文件进行写操作,可以防止因为错误的操作导致的数据损坏。通过系统日志监测不当访问行为,及时调整权限设置,也能在提升性能的保证系统的稳定性。
通过对文件权限的细致管理,用户不仅能够保护个人数据的安全,还能提升整体系统的性能。结合最新的市场趋势和技术工具,文件权限管理已不再是单一的设置,而是一种动态的、持续优化的过程。无论是在企业办公环境还是个人使用场景中,掌握文件权限管理的要领都是确保信息安全与系统高效运转的重要保障。
常见问题解答
1. 什么是文件权限?
文件权限是指操作系统对文件或目录的访问控制,包括读、写和执行权限。
2. 操作系统如何定义用户权限?
操作系统通过文件属性中设定的权限来区分不同用户对文件的访问权限。
3. 如何管理Linux系统中的文件权限?
使用`chmod`命令可修改文件权限,`chown`命令可更改文件所有者。
4. ACL与传统文件权限有什么不同?
ACL允许对文件设定更细化的权限,而传统权限仅提供读、写、执行三种基本权限。
5. 如何提高文件权限管理的安全性?
可采用SELinux等安全机制,结合日志监控和定期审计,确保文件权限的适当设置和保护。